. , <br /> Mass Transit Memorandum <br /> No. 061104-1 <br /> June 11,2004 <br /> TO: Honorable Mayor Osborne and City Council Members <br /> FROM: Steve Garman, City Manager <br /> Paul McChancy, Mass Transit Administrator �a�� <br /> SUBJECT: IDOT Contract for Mass Transit Study for FY-2005 <br /> SUMMARY Staff recommends that Council adopt a Resolution approving an <br /> RECOMMENDATION: agreement with the Illinois Department of Transportation (IDOT) <br /> for a grant to fund staff Transit planning work for FY-2005. <br /> BACKGROUND: Each year the Illinois Department of Transportation (IDOT) <br /> allocates funds for planning work to be done by transit agencies. <br /> Staff has proposed to expend up to $41,716, matched by $10,429 <br /> of City funds, for a total of$52,145. The funds would be used to <br /> finance staff work in support of the Transit System in two broad <br /> areas: analysis of how well the system performs today, and <br /> planning for the future. A list of work elements and costs is <br /> attached. All work will be performed by City staff and Transit <br /> System employees; no consultants or outside vendors will be used. <br /> This program of work elements was included in the FY 2005 <br /> Unified Transportation Planning Work Program developed and <br /> approved by the Decatur Urbanized Area Transportation Study <br /> (DUATS). <br /> POTENTIAL No known objection to this contract. <br />' OBJECTION: <br /> INPUT FROM Richard Foiles, General Manager <br /> OTHER SOURCES: Decatur Public Transit System <br /> STAFF REFERENCE: Paul McChancy, Mass Transit Administratar <br />' BUDGET/TIME Only City staff and Transit System employees will be involved in <br /> IMPLICATIONS: this work. Since their time is already accounted for as an operating <br /> cost in the City's FY 2004-2005 budget, there is no added cost <br /> to the City. IDOT's share for this program, at 80%, is higher than <br /> their share for normal operating costs - only 55%. The time frame <br /> is the State fiscal year -July 1, 2004 through June 30, 2005. <br />
